java.nio.file.Paths
This class consists exclusively of static methods that return a 
Path
 by converting a path string or URI.- API Note:
 - It is recommended to obtain a 
Pathvia thePath.ofmethods instead of via thegetmethods defined in this class as this class may be deprecated in a future release. - Since:
 - 1.7

get
Converts a path string, or a sequence of strings that when joined form a path string, to aPath.- Implementation Requirements:
 - This method simply invokes 
Path.of(String, String...)with the given parameters. - Parameters:
 first- the path string or initial part of the path stringmore- additional strings to be joined to form the path string- Returns:
 - the resulting 
Path - Throws:
 InvalidPathException- if the path string cannot be converted to aPath- See Also:

get
Converts the given URI to aPathobject.- Implementation Requirements:
 - This method simply invokes 
Path.of(URI)with the given parameter. - Parameters:
 uri- the URI to convert- Returns:
 - the resulting 
Path - Throws:
 IllegalArgumentException- if preconditions on theuriparameter do not hold. The format of the URI is provider specific.FileSystemNotFoundException- The file system, identified by the URI, does not exist and cannot be created automatically, or the provider identified by the URI's scheme component is not installedSecurityException- if a security manager is installed and it denies an unspecified permission to access the file system- See Also:
